Abia APC Raises Alarm Over Alleged Threat to Evict Renewed Hope Partners from Office
The All Progressives Congress (APC), in Isiala Ngwa South Local Government Area of Abia State has raised concerns over an alleged threat by the Mayor of the council, Mr. Nnadozie Nwogwugwu, to evict Renewed Hope Partners from their office in the area.
The party alleged that the move was aimed at taking over the property for use by the Labour Party.
Speaking to newsmen, the APC Chairman in Isiala Ngwa South, Barr. Chika Uhuaba, said the office space was duly rented by the party for the activities of Renewed Hope Partners, with full payment already made to the landlord.
“We rented the office space for the activities of Renewed Hope Partners and made full payment to the landlord.
However, after we hosted a senatorial aspirant for Abia Central during his consultation visit to the area, the Mayor began pressuring the landlord to evict us,” Uhuaba said.
He further alleged that the landlord was threatened with revocation of the property if he failed to comply.
“The Mayor has been telling the landlord to evict us or face revocation of the property, insisting that the state government needs the place for use,” he stated.
Uhuaba questioned why the Abia State Government, under Governor Alex Otti, which he said had consistently declared support for the re-election of President Bola Ahmed Tinubu, would allegedly move against those pursuing the same agenda.
“It is surprising that a government which claims to support the President’s re-election would turn around to persecute partners working for the same cause,” he said.
He called on Governor Otti to intervene and caution the council Mayor, stressing that such actions were against democratic principles.
“We call on Governor Otti to call the Mayor of Isiala Ngwa South to order, because such moves negate the tenets of democracy,” Uhuaba added.
